A polpa de caju concentrada apresentou as melhores notas nos atributos sensoriais avaliados. / The cashew (Anacardium occidentale, L.) has a great economic importance to the Northeast region, notably for the great acceptance by consumers, both for their sensory properties (color, aroma, flavor, texture) as for its nutritional and functional values. It stands out among the fruit species native to the Northeast because it has high potential for fresh consumption and industrial processing. The cashew and cashew apple juice are important components of the human diet because they are considered a natural source of carbohydrates, carotenoids, vitamins and phenolic compounds, substances with high antioxidant potential, and have attracted the interest of various research groups. This work aimed to study the stability of cashew apple pulp with preservatives, pasteurized and concentrated frozen storage for 12 months, through to chemical, physical-chemical and microbiological analysis. And production of cashew apple nectar and cashew apple sweetened tropical juice and sensorial stability during 360 days of storage of the pulp. The pulps showed no significant interaction for pH, soluble solids, acidity and color coordinated. The pH and soluble solids varied with time but remained within standards legislation. The acidity no change during the storage. The color coordinate set to the cubic model. The parameters vitamin C ranged from 190.65 to 308.45 in the pulp with preservatives, 170.95 to 299.70 in the pulp pasteurized and from 514.68 to 865.42 mg/100g in concentrated pulp, these values very expressive. Dark pigments soluble, brightness, hue*, chroma*, carotenoids, pulp content, total sugar showed significant interaction were assessed by regression with time varying storage except color coordinate b. The concentration of total sugars remained around 10.01 to 13.25% for pulps with preservatives and pasteurized,and to 24 to 27% in the concentrated pulp, which are mostly represented by sugars. The microbiological analyses confirmed the effectiveness of the processing, thermal treatment and concentration in the maintenance of the microbiological quality, once growth of microorganisms was not observed in the product during the storage period. The cashew apple nectars and juices sweetened have good acceptability in all sensory attributes. The frozen pulps cashew with preservatives, pasteurized and concentrated is viable since no significant losses occur in the quality of products.

O trabalho visa fornecer subsídios técnicos que auxiliem os agricultores no processo de tomada de decisão quanto à estratégia mais adequada para a administração do risco de chuvas de granizo em seus pomares, auxiliem as empresas de seguro na elaboração de novos contratos em suas carteiras agrícolas e, também, o governo no desenvolvimento de novas políticas voltadas ao setor agropecuário. / The damage caused by hailstorms is one of the most important problems faced by the apple producers, in Brazil, and in other countries. This work presents, from a literature review and local surveys within the apple producing region in Santa Catarina State, Brazil, a characterization of the hail risk problem and an evaluation of existing alternatives for risk management. The alternatives considered in the risk management process included: commercial insurance, mutual insurance, spatial diversification, antihail nets, hail rockets and ground burners. Besides, the research presents a conceptual model that uses decision diagrams to describe the qualitative relationship among the different alternatives for administration of the hail risk and the most important variables for the problem. The decision diagram guided the development of a software tool designed to help the selection of the best combination of alternatives for hail risk management. This software tool, implemented in a spreadsheet, was used in a case study involving an association of apple producers in São Joaquim, SC. The intention of this work is to aid apple producers in the selection of the most appropriate strategy for the administration of the risk of hailstorms in their orchards, aid the insurance companies in the design of new contracts in your agricultural portfolio and, also, aid the government in the development of new agricultural policies.

AgÃncia Nacional do PetrÃleo / CoordenaÃÃo de AperfeÃoamento de Pessoal de NÃvel Superior / In this work, the ethanol production from cashew bagasse was studied after acid followed by alkali pretreatment (CAB-OH) using the Separate Hydrolysis and Fermentation (SHF) and Simultaneous Saccharification and Fermentation (SSF) processes. In SHF process, the hydrolysate obtained from enzymatic hydrolysis of CAB-OH was used as carbon source for fermentation with different strains of Saccharomyces (S. cerevisiae CCA008, S. cerevisiae 01, S. cerevisiae 02 and Saccharomyces sp. 1238), Kluyveromyces (K. marxianus CCA510, CE025 and ATCC36907) and Hanseniaspora sp. GPBio03. The bioprocess was conducted at 30 ÂC and 50 g.L-1 initial glucose concentration. The K. marxianus ATCC36907 achieved ethanol concentration of 20 g.L-1 with consumption of all glucose in the hydrolysate. Similar results were obtained with Saccharomyces strains and higher ethanol concentration (23.43 g.L-1) was obtained by Saccharomyces sp. 1238. The maximum ethanol concentration of 24.54 g.L-1 was achieved by Hanseniaspora sp. GPBio03. Focused on further studies using SSF process, it was evaluated the temperature influence of thermotolerant yeast K. marxianus ATCC36907 in glucose and enzymatic hydrolysate from CAB-OH. The results showed that the temperature (30, 35, 40, 45 and 50 ÂC) did not affect the values of YE/G (0.45 to 0.46 gethanol/gglucose) using glucose as substrate. Moreover, the ethanol yields obtained with enzymatic hydrolysate were slightly influenced by temperature, 0.39 and 0.43 gethanol/gglucose were obtained at 30 and 40 ÂC, respectively. Based on this, the SSF of CAB-OH and K. marxianus ATCC36907 was conducted at 40 ÂC with cellulases from Celluclast 1.5L at 15 FPU/gcellulose. The highest ethanol concentration (24.90  0.89 g.L-1) was obtained with 76h of fermentation with 0.33 g.L-1.h-1, 0.34 gethanol/gglucose and 66.3% of productivity, YʹE/G and of ethanol efficiency, respectively. In enzymatic hydrolysis studies, the cellulase NS 22074 at 30 FPU/gcellulose without cellobiases supplementation resulted in glucose yield of 93.77  2.72% which is promising for studies of SSF with this enzyme complex. The temperature (40, 42 , 45 and 50 ÂC) influence in SSF process using microcrystalline cellulose, in contrast with SHF results, higher ethanol concentration, 19.86  0.32 g.L-1, was obtained at 40 ÂC. The SSF using CAB-OH, 30 FPU/gcellulose cellulases NS 22074 at 40 ÂC showed higher ethanol concentration of 37.35  0.64 g.L-1 at 80h, with productivity of 0.46 g.L-1.h-1. In this condition, there was an increase of YʹE/G from 0.34 to 0.49 gethanol/gglucose and the ethanol efficiency from 66.3% to 95.59% when compared to results obtained with SSF using Celluclast 1.5L. Ces résultats confortent la nécessité d’une prise en compte explicite de l’interdépendance ‘pratiques x conditions du milieu’ pour analyser les services. / The concept of « ecosystem service », which has been used increasingly since the publication of the Millennium Ecosystem Assessment in 2005, has highlighted the importance of ecosystem’s non-marketed performances. In orchards, ensuring high productivity while preserving natural resources and human health has become a real challenge that could be analyzed with the concept of ecosystem service. Which ecosystem services are delivered in an apple orchard? How to analyze them? What are the relationships - conflicts or synergies – among multiple ecosystem services and how do cropping systems change multiple ecosystem service profiles? This PhD work aims at answering those questions with an innovative approach combining experimental measures, modeling and statistical analysis.Based on a literature review of ecosystem services in orchards, five services were selected: fruit production, nitrogen availability in soil, climate regulation based on the prevention of nitrogen denitrification and on carbon sequestration, maintenance and regulation of water cycle, including water quality, and pest control. We also considered the environmental disturbances caused by the use of pesticides. For each service, we identified the underlying ecosystem functions as well as the agricultural practices and soil and climate conditions affecting these functions. Services and functions were described by one or multiple indicators and quantified using models in the case of (i) nine existing cropping systems on two experimental sites in southeastern France differing in terms of soil and climate conditions, and (ii) 150 virtual cropping systems designed out of the combination of five major agricultural practice levers and their modalities, in identical soil and climate conditions. The two models used were STICS, a generic soil-crop simulation model under the influence of practices which required a parameterization and an evaluation on apple orchards based on experimental measures, and IPSIM, a generic modeling framework simulating the impacts of agricultural practices and local conditions on crop injuries caused by pests. IPSIM was parameterized on apple orchards, based on an important literature review and expert opinions. Model simulations were analyzed with simple statistics in the case of the nine existing cropping systems and with two-table multivariate analyses (principal component analysis with instrumental variables) for virtual cropping systems.Concerning the existing cropping systems, 14 important relationships were identified among ecosystem services, especially conflicts, like the one between nitrogen denitrification or leaching prevention and soil nitrogen availability on the short term, and synergies such as the one between soil humidity or carbon sequestration and nitrogen availability on the short term. These relationships are explained by the underlying ecosystem functions. Comparing service profiles among cropping systems highlighted the impacts of agricultural practices on some services. That way, on a same site, a high planting density increases fruit production and carbon sequestration. An exclusively organic fertilization decreases fruit production through nitrogen stress but also nitrogen leaching in drained water. Furthermore, service profiles are strongly influenced by the soil and climate conditions of each site. These results strengthen the need to explicitly consider the ‘agricultural practices x soil and climate conditions’ interdependence in order to analyze ecosystem services. The results obtained with the virtual cropping systems simulations confirmed those of the existing ones and gave precision on the impacts of fertilization, irrigation and pest control for codling moth, rosy apple aphid and apple scab on ecosystem functions and services.

Estudos histológicos do tecido hepático confirmaram as avaliações bioquímicas exibindo preservação tecidual, supressão de degeneração vacuolar macro e microgoticular e de sinais necróticos nos ratos tratados com a fração de ácidos fenólicos livres do pedúnculo de caju. / Phenolic compounds are widely distributed in the plant kingdom, particularly fruits and vegetables. Due to their chemical structure, these compounds, in particular flavonoids and phenolic acids, are able to inhibit oxidative processes. Furthermore, can be used to reduce the risk of non-transmissible chronic diseases such as cardiovascular diseases, cancer and atherosclerosis. Taking into consideration the large production of cashew in Brazil and the possible existence of potentially antioxidant compounds present in the cashew apples, the aim of this study was to quantitatively and qualitatively evaluate the presence of phenolic compounds in cashew apple, particularly phenolic acids, and identify their role in metabolic processes in animals. The cashew apples of three distinct clones (CCP-76, CCP-09, BRS-189 and CCP-76 (processed)) were studied. The determination of fatty acids yielded a high concentration of monounsaturated fatty acids, mainly oleic acid, and of total phenolic compound. The phenolic acids found were: gallic, proteocatechuic, p-cumaric, ferulic, caffeic and salicylic acids. Both aqueous (EAq) and ethanolic (EAlc) extracts and phenolic acid fractions were obtained from the cashew apples and were evaluated in a β-carotene/linoleate model system and Rancimat test. The phenolic acid fractions presented an expressive antioxidant activity in the β-carotene/linoleate model system and the extracts, by the Rancimat test presented a protection factor higher than that of antioxidant additive, BHT. We also observed the antioxidant capacity of the extracts and fractions of the CCP-76 clone in the DPPH radical scavenging assay. In an experimental assay with rats, the EAq (80 and 240 mg/kg) or the free phenolic acid fraction (40 and 120 mg/kg) obtained from the cashew apple of CCP-76 clone was administered via the oral route. In this study, the enhancement of enzymatic antioxidants (superoxide dismutase, catalase, glutathione peroxidase and reductase) was not observed, nevertheless, a decrease in the amount of lipoperoxidation in the brain tissue was observed, suggesting that the ingestion of cashew might increase the antioxidative state in animals. Also, the antioxidant activity of EAq and of the free phenolic acid fraction from the cashew apple of CCP-76 clone was verified on the liver damage induced by carbon tetrachloride. The liver damage caused by the administration of carbon tetrachloride was detected by biochemical parameters, namely, the increase in the serum concentrations of alanine transaminase (ALT) and aspartate transaminase (AST) as well as a decrease in the activities of antioxidant enzymes and an increase in peroxidation in the liver. Rats who received EAq (480 mg/kg, p.o.) did not present alterations in any of the parameters evaluated, compared to the animals treated with carbon tetrachloride. On the other hand, the administration of free the phenolic acid fraction in doses of 40 and 120 mg/kg, p.o., had a pronounced effect in protecting against hepatic lesion, which was evidenced by the decrease in plasma ALT and AST, enhancing the activity of antioxidant enzymes and preventing lipoperoxidation mediated by the CCl3• radical generated by carbon tetrachloride. Histological studies were able to confirm the biochemical alterations observed in that the liver tissue obtained from rats treated with phenolic acid fractions extracted from cashew apple of CCP-76 clone presented a preserved tissue structure and suppression of macro and microgoticular vacuolar degeneration as well as of signs of necrosis.

Characterizing the Third-Party Authentication Landscape : A Longitudinal Study of how Identity Providers are Used in Modern Websites / Longitudinella mätningar av användandet av tredjepartsautentisering på moderna hemsidor

Josefsson Ågren, Fredrik, Järpehult, Oscar January 2021 (has links)
Third-party authentication services are becoming more common since it eases the login procedure by not forcing users to create a new login for every website thatuses authentication. Even though it simplifies the login procedure the users still have to be conscious about what data is being shared between the identity provider (IDP) and the relying party (RP). This thesis presents a tool for collecting data about third-party authentication that outperforms previously made tools with regards to accuracy, precision and recall. The developed tool was used to collect information about third-party authentication on a set of websites. The collected data revealed that third-party login services offered by Facebook and Google are most common and that Twitters login service is significantly less common. Twitter's login service shares the most data about the users to the RPs and often gives the RPs permissions to perform write actions on the users Twitter account.  In addition to our large-scale automatic data collection, three manual data collections were performed and compared to previously made manual data collections from a nine-year period. The longitudinal comparison showed that over the nine-year period the login services offered by Facebook and Google have been dominant.It is clear that less information about the users are being shared today compared to earlier years for Apple, Facebook and Google. The Twitter login service is the only IDP that have not changed their permission policies. This could be the reason why the usage of the Twitter login service on websites have decreased.  The results presented in this thesis helps provide a better understanding of what personal information is exchanged by IDPs which can guide users to make well educated decisions on the web.

Stanovení autenticity potravin rostlinného původu pomocí molekulárních metod / Determination of athenticity of plant foods by molecular techniques

Plášková, Anna January 2020 (has links)
The aim of presented diploma thesis was to determination of authenticity of fruit baby foods for early infant feeding using molecular methods. In the experimental part, isolation kit was used for isolation of plant DNA from fruits (strawberry, apricot, raspberry, apple) and from six commercial fruit products for children. Isolated DNA was characterized and verified using PCR methods with primers specific for plant rDNA (ITS2). Specific primer pairs were designed to amplify DNA for the detection of one fruit species. Primer specificity was assessed with four fruit species. A mixture of fruit puree from the two fruits was used to determine the sensitivity of the multiplex PCR assay. Six commercial fruit products were evaluated to verify the applicability of the multiplex PCR assay. The methodology of molecular detection of fruit DNA by qPCR and multiplex qPCR (duplex) includes approaches, which enable to detect two fruits (strawberry-raspberry, apricot-apple) in one reaction and thus reduces time and money requirements.

Detekce objektů / Detection of Object

Šenkýř, Ivo January 2008 (has links)
This diploma thesis deals with a problem of spores venturia inaequlis recognition. These spores are captured on a special tape which is then analyzed using a microscope. The tape can be analyzed by a laboratorian or by the program Sporedetect v3. This program provides functions for complete picture processing and object recognition. In this diploma thesis, there are also described ways to automatically control a sliding stage of a microscope utilizing motorized translation stages and linear actuators. The information about automatic control of a microscope stage was obtained from catalogues of the companies Standa and Edmundoptics.

Par ailleurs, les résultats ont montré que l’électrofiltration sur membrane permettait de purifier les polyphénols dans l’espace anodique (+) et d’obtenir un volume plus important de filtrats. / This thesis focuses on the intensification of polyphenols extraction from apple products (flesh, peel, and pomace) by ultrasound (US) and the purification of apple peel extracts by adsorption/desorption and membrane technology. The selective extraction of phenolic contents from apple products has been analyzed. The obtained data evidenced the possibility of fine regulation of selective extraction of soluble matter, catechin and total polyphenolic compounds using different temperatures, ultrasound-assisted extraction (UAE) protocols, ethanol/aqueous mixtures. The selectivity of catechin extraction was also depended on the type of the tissue (flesh, peel or pomace) and apple variety (green or red). The cavitation phenomenon generated by ultrasound could increase extraction of valuable components from fruit peels by damaging cell membranes of samples and accelerating heat and mass transfer by disrupted cell walls of samples. Meanwhile, the gas water solvents could enhance the extraction efficiency of polyphenols and antioxidant activity from apple peels by enhancing cavitation phenomenon generated by ultrasound. The efficiency of polyphenols purification from apple peel extracts with adsorption/desorption process by ultrasound treatment with the polyaromatic amberlite adsorbent XAD-16 and with membrane electro-filtration were studied. The obtained data demonstrated that the sonication significantly facilitated adsorption kinetics and increased activation energy of polyphenols adsorption. In addition, the desorption ratio was positively affected by the sonication during the adsorption step. On the other hand, the results demonstrated that the membrane electro-filtration allowed the purification of polyphenols in the anode (+) space and obtaining larger volume of filtrates.
